Grand Prix Hero is an arcade style formula racing game where players compete in high speed races on international tracks, dodging busy traffic and taking every opportunity to get ahead. In any race you have to have quick reflexes, a good eye, and be able to make the right decisions if you want to win the top step of the podium.
It’s not just about flooring it to the finish line; players have to always watch the cars in front of them, pick the right spot and use every acceleration zone to their advantage. Very rapid pace for each race. In only a few minutes you will have to make dozens of lane changes and overtakes, as well as deal with unexpected events.
Grand Prix Hero has very easy to learn controls.

No brakes, no gear changes, no complicated cornering tweaks. But that doesn’t imply the game is simple.
At high speeds the space between vehicles is always changing. All it takes is to choose the wrong path or respond a split second too slowly and a collision and a major loss of speed, which gives opponents an opportunity to overtake, will happen.

Collect coins during every race. Once the race is finished, you can spend those coins to upgrade your car's speed, handling and overall performance.
Yes. Every collision slows your car significantly, allowing opponents to overtake you and directly affecting your finishing position.
Yes. You race across multiple international tracks, and the difficulty increases as you progress through the game.
Quick reflexes, the ability to anticipate traffic ahead, and choosing the right moment to change lanes are the key skills for achieving high scores.
